Ipamorelin is a peptide that signals the pituitary gland to release growth hormone through selective receptor activation. Research has shown it stimulates growth hormone release without significantly affecting cortisol or prolactin levels. Studies have examined its effects on growth hormone pulsatility, body composition, and bone density in various models.

Current Research
  • Growth hormone release via ghrelin receptor
  • Post-operative recovery models
  • Appetite and gastrointestinal motility
